Willie Spence has been singing for almost as long as he can remember. His journey began around the age of four when he began singing at his grandfather’s church. Willie attended Coffee High school and initially his experience there wasn’t much different than other students. An experience at Coffee High school, however, would mark a turning point in Willie’s path to budding fame. Willie was 18 years old when a friend filmed him singing Rihanna’s “Diamonds” while sitting in their high school sports hall. The cover went viral after ending up on YouTube and launched the beginning of a large social media following for Willie that includes over 534,0000 subscribers on YouTube.

For his American Idol audition, Willie sang “Diamonds” by Rihanna. During Hollywood week, Willie solidified his status as a frontrunner when he performed “All of Me” by John Legend for the genre challenge. After the performance, Judge Lionel Richie said, “"Your career is right there for you, I don’t want to waste any more time,” and judges advanced him through to the next round. For the Duets round, Willie was paired with fellow contestant Kya Monee and the pair performed “Stay” by Rihanna.
The performance brought judge Katy Perry to tears and Judge Lionel Richie said, “That performance was divine, That was an experience,”
